St. Stanislas Kostka

Born at Rostkovo near Prasnysz, Poland, about October 28, 1550; died at Rome during the night of
14-15 August, 1568. He entered the Society of Jesus at Rome, October 28, 1567, and is said to
have foretold his death a few days before it occurred. His father, John Kostka, was a senator of the
Kingdom of Poland and Lord of Zakroczym; his mother was Margaret de Drobniy Kryska, the sister
and niece of the Dukes Palatine of Masovia and the aunt of the celebrated Chancellor of Poland,
Felix Kryski. The marriage was blessed with seven children, of whom Stanislas was the second. His
older brother Paul survived him long enough to be present at the celebration of the beatification of
Stanislas in 1605.
